Hi all the bearings in my final drive collapsed last year and I had them replaced by a local chap. All the bearings and seals inside I got them from Motroworks all new. I have now made about 3000 miles when I decided to replace the oil from the final drive to make sure nothing weird came out. The oil came out dark grey. The chap who did the job thinks it may be residual grease from the bearings since they were new and the heat has disolved it in the oil. (The oil I used was clear by the way). I noticed in the oil that came out very fine metal particles that I managed to isolate with a strong magnet. There are just a few but very fine. My question would be, if someone had the internal bearings replaced, if they found the same issue. Is it normal or is there something wrong going on inside?
